Casa de Rancho Cucamonga

Search Rancho Cucamonga California

Associated with the historic Cucamonga Rancho, this is the oldest fired-brick house in San Bernardino County. It has been restored and furnished in the style of the 1800's. Tours are available by appointment.

Location: Vineyard and Hemlock, Rancho Cucamonga California Telephone 909-989-4970
